Official abstract text for this publication.
Various solutions to handling of registration rejects with respect to user equipment (UE) in mobile communications are described. A UE may transmit a first request to a first network element of a wireless network. The UE may receive a first reject from the first network element. The UE may bar the first network element in response to receiving the first reject from the first network element. The UE may transmit a second request to a second network element of the same wireless network or a different wireless network in response to receiving the first reject from the first network element. Alternatively, the UE may transmit a second request to the first network element after a period of barring time.

What is claimed is: 1 . A method, comprising: transmitting a first request to a first network element of a first type of wireless network; receiving a first reject from the first network element; barring the first network element in response to receiving the first reject from the first network element; and transmitting a second request to a second network element of the first type of wireless network in response to receiving the first reject from the first network element. 2 . The method of claim 1 , further comprising: receiving a second reject from the second network element; and switching to communications with a second type of wireless network in response to receiving the first and the second rejects. 3 . The method of claim 1 , further comprising: receiving an acceptance indication from the second network element; and storing an identification associated with the first network element such that first network element is not selected again when attempting to establish communications with the first type of wireless network again. 4 . The method of claim 3 , wherein the first network element comprises a first Evolved Node B (eNodeB), a first Node B or a first Base Transceiver Station (BTS) of a first Public Land Mobile Network (PLMN), and wherein the second network element comprises a second eNodeB, a second Node B or a second BTS of the first PLMN. 5 . The method of claim 1 , wherein the first request comprises a first tracking area update (TAU) request, a first routing area update (RAU) request, a first service request or a first location update request, wherein the first reject comprises a first TAU reject, a first RAU reject, a first service reject or a first location update reject without integrity protection received, wherein the second request comprises a second TAU request, a second RAU request, a second service request or a second location update request, and wherein the second reject comprises a second TAU reject, a second RAU reject, a second service reject or a second location update reject without integrity protection. 6 . A method, comprising: transmitting a first request to a first network element of a first type of wireless network; receiving a first reject from the first network element; barring the first network element for a period of barring time in response to receiving the first reject from the first network element; and transmitting a second request to the first network element after the period of barring time. 7 . The method of claim 6 , further comprising: receiving a second reject from the first network element; and switching to communications with a second type of wireless network in response to receiving the second rejects. 8 . The method of claim 6 , further comprising: receiving a second reject from the first network element; and storing an identification associated with the first network element. 9 . The method of claim 8 , wherein the first network element comprises an Evolved Node B (eNodeB), a Node B or a Base Transceiver Station (BTS), and wherein the identification associated with the first network element comprises an identification of a cell associated with the first network element, an identification of a Public Land Mobile Network (PLMN) associated with the first network element, or a combination thereof. 10 . The method of claim 8 , further comprising performing one of a number of operations, the operations comprising: refraining from attempting to establish communications with the first type of wireless network; and waiting for a period of wait time before attempting to establish communications with the first type of wireless network. 11 . The method of claim 6 , wherein the first request comprises a first tracking area update (TAU) request, a first routing area update (RAU) request, a first service request or a first location update request, wherein the first reject comprises a first TAU reject, a first RAU reject, a first service reject or a first location update reject without integrity protection, and wherein the second request comprises a second TAU request, a second RAU request, a second service request or a second location update request. 12 . A method, comprising: transmitting a first request to a first network element of a first wireless network; receiving a first reject from the first network element; barring a tracking area, a routing area or a location area associated with the first network element or the first wireless network in response to receiving the first reject from the first network element; starting a back-off timer; and transmitting a second request to a second network element of a second wireless network either immediately or after the period of barring time. 13 . The method of claim 12 , further comprising: receiving a second reject from the second network element; stopping the back-off timer; and performing one or more operations pertaining to a situation of a user equipment (UE) having an invalid Subscriber Identify Module (SIM) card. 14 . The method of claim 13 , wherein the first network element comprises a first Evolved Node B (eNodeB) of a first Public Land Mobile Network (PLMN), and wherein the second network element comprises a second eNodeB of a second PLMN. 15 . The method of claim 12 , further comprising: receiving a second reject from the second network element; stopping the back-off timer; and performing one or more operations pertaining to a situation of a user equipment (UE) having a valid Subscriber Identify Module (SIM) card and being denied of services from at least the first wireless network and the second wireless network.
